PDFWord文档格式.docx
- 文档编号:22587274
- 上传时间:2023-02-04
- 格式:DOCX
- 页数:11
- 大小:986.89KB
PDFWord文档格式.docx
《PDFWord文档格式.docx》由会员分享,可在线阅读,更多相关《PDFWord文档格式.docx(11页珍藏版)》请在冰豆网上搜索。
4.1用32位二进制2的补码表示法表示数(512)10分析与解答:
„(512)10
„=(1000000000)2
„=(00000000000000000000001000000000)2
4.2用32位二进制2的补码表示法表示数-(1023)10
„
„-(1023)10
„=-(1111111111)2
„=(10000000000000000000001111111111)原
„=(11111111111111111111110000000001)补
4.4给出如下用二进制2的补码表示法表示的数的十进制数:
(11111111111111111111111000001100)2分析与解答:
„(11111111111111111111111000001100)补
„=(10000000000000000000000111110011)反
„=(10000000000000000000000111110100)原
„=-(111110100)2
„=-500
4.8给出二进制数(11001010111111101111101011001110)2的十六进制数
„分析与解答:
„(Hex)0-F<
=>
(B)0000-1111
„(11001010111111101111101011001110)2
„=(1210151415101214)
„=(CAFEFACE)16
4.14二进制数的各个数位本身并不是天生就有某种特定的含义。
请考虑如下的二进制
位串:
10001111111011111100000000000000若它分别表示如下所示的三种数,那么他们的含义各是什么?
2的补码表示的整数无符号整数„单精度浮点数
„2的补码表示的整数„(10001111111011111100000000000000)补
„=(11110000000100000100000000000000)原
„=-(1110000000100000100000000000000)
„=-(1880113152)10
„无符号整数„(10001111111011111100000000000000)
„=+(10001111111011111100000000000000)
„=+(2414854144)10
„
3.9设机器字长16位。
定点表示时,数值15位,符号位1位;
浮点表示时,阶码6位,其中阶符1位,尾数10位,其中,数符1位;
阶码底为2。
试求:
„1)定点原码整数表示时,最大正数、最小负数各是多少?
„2)定点原码小数表示时,最大正数、最小负数各是多少?
„3)浮点原码表示时,最大浮点数和最小浮点数各是多少?
绝对值最小的呢(非0)?
估算表示的十进制值的有效数字位数。
3.12写出下列各数的移码+01101101„-11001101„-00010001„+00011101
3.19用补码一位乘计算X=0.1010,Y=-0.0110的积X•Y
X=0.1010->
(00.1010)原->
(00.1010)补
„Y=-0.0110->
(10.0110)原->
(11.1010)补
„-X=-0.1010->
(10.1010)原->
(11.0110)补
3.21X=0.10110,Y=0.11111,用加减交替法补码一位除计算X/Y的商
„X=0.10110->
(00.10110)原
„Y=0.11111->
(00.11111)原
„-Y=-0.11111->
(10.11111)原
->
(11.00001)补
6.15设有主频为16MHz的微处理器,平均每条指令的执行时间为两个机器周期,每个机器周期由两个时钟脉冲组成。
问:
„
(1)存储器为“0等待”,求机器速度
„
(2)假如每两个机器周期中有一个是访存周期,需插入1个时钟周期的等待时间,求机器速度(“0等待”表示存储器可在一个机器周期完成读/写操作,因此不需要插入等待时间)
„平均每条指令的执行时间为两个机器周期,每个机器周期由两个时钟脉冲组成
„
(1)存储器为“0等待”时:
16MHz=>
16M脉冲/s=>
8M机器周期/s=>
4M指令周期/s=>
4MIPS
„
(2)每两个机器周期中有一个是访存周期,需插入1个时钟周期的等待时间:
一个访存周期需要2个机器周期+另一个机器周期=3个机器周期=>
6个时钟脉冲=>
16/6MIPS=2.67MIPS
7.3设某流水线计算机有一个指令和数据合一的cache,已知cache的读/写时间为10ns,主存的读/写时间为100ns,取指的命中率为98%,数据的命中率为95%,在执行程序时,约有1/5指令需要存/取一个操作数,为简化起见,假设指令流水线在任何时候都不阻塞。
问设置cache后,与无cache比较,计算机的运算速度可提高多少倍?
取指令时间10ns×
98%+(10ns+100ns)×
2%=12ns
取数据时间(10ns×
95%+(10ns+100ns)×
5%)×
1/5=3ns
∴平均访存时间=取指令时间+取数据时间=15ns
无cache时:
„平均访存时间=100ns+100ns×
1/5=120ns
∴运算速度提高=120ns/15ns=8倍
7.5设某计算机的cache采用4路组相联映像,已知cache容量为16KB,主存容量为2MB,每个字块有8个字,每个字有32位。
请回答:
(1)主存地址多少位(按字节编址),各字段如何划分(各需多少位)?
(2)设cache起始为空,CPU从主存单元0,1,…,100依次读出101个字(主存一次读一个字),并重复按此次序数读11次,问命中率为多少?
若cache速度是主存的5倍,问采用cache与无cache比较速度提高多少倍?
7.6设某计算机采用直接映像cache,已知容量是4096B。
(1)若CPU依次从主存单元0,1,…,99和4096,4097,…,4195交替取指令,循环执行10次,问命中率为多少?
(2)如cache存取时间为10ns,主存存取时间为100ns,cache命中率为95%,求平均存取时间。
„
(1)命中率=0
„
(2)平均存取时间=10×
95%+(100+10)×
5%=15ns
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词: